ACCA Creates Summer Arts Program
What is Summer Arts?
For the second year, ACCA Creates is working in collaboration with Keys 2 Success!
Summer Arts is an immersive arts program that is free of cost to all students. Breakfast and lunch will also be provided to participating campers. Student Artists engage in six weeks of arts training in community activism, creative writing, dance, music-piano/voice, theater, and visual art, culminating in performances in selected county and city parks of Newark. Classes are from 9am-4pm. This immersive summer arts program culminates with a showcase of students' works of art/creative writing, works in progress, and a production of Lion King Jr.
Summer Arts will conclude with performances by the students during the week of August 8-13 after camp hours. More information about the performance schedule can be found on the ACCA Creates Instagram page (@acca.creates).

Isaac Mizrahi returns to Café Carlyle, February 14-25
Isaac Mizrahi returns to Café Carlyle with his all-new show, The Marvelous Mr. Mizrahi, for a two-week residency, February 14-25. His previous residencies in the room were sellouts, receiving widespread critical acclaim. Accompanied by his band of jazz musicians led by Ben Waltzer, Mizrahi will perform a range of tunes from Arthur Freed to Grace Jones. The New York Times noted, “he qualifies as a founding father of a genre that fuses performance art, music and stand-up comedy.”
Isaac Mizrahi has worked extensively in the entertainment industry as a performer, host, writer, designer and producer for over 30 years. Along with his annual residency at Café Carlyle, Isaac has performed at various venues across the country such as Joe’s Pub, The Regency Ballroom, several City Winery locations nationwide and comes to the Carlyle fresh from his run as Amos Hart in the Broadway production of CHICAGO. He is the subject and co-creator of Unzipped, a documentary following the making of his Fall 1994 collection which received an award at the Sundance Film Festival. He hosted his own television talk show, “The Isaac Mizrahi Show” for seven years, has written three books, and has made countless appearances in movies and on television. He served as a judge on Project Runway: All-Stars for the series’ entire seven-season run.

Brass Queens
Brass Queens is an 8-piece brass band whose sound is deeply inspired by the music of New Orleans mixed with the flair of modern pop. Hailing from Brooklyn, NY, the Brass Queens features an all-female horn section with the goal of expanding the space for women in a male-dominated industry. Brass Queens has performed at the 2021 Met Gala, on Good Morning America, Governor's Ball Music Festival, Exit Zero Jazz Festival, Chanel No. 5’s 125th anniversary, and for notable clients including Saks Fifth Avenue, Tiffany & Co., Perrier, Instagram, New Balance, and many more.
